This position will be hired as Project Manager level I or II depending on experience.


Job Summary:

The Project Manager leads and manages enterprise projects that align with organizational goals. This role is responsible for driving the successful initiation, planning, execution, and completion of projects through structured methodologies, strong stakeholder collaboration, and performance accountability. The Project Manager I ensures projects are executed efficiently, with measurable impact, while also fostering cross-functional alignment and supporting enterprise-wide transformation initiatives. The role requires both strategic thinking and tactical execution across a variety of business units, functions, and systems.

 

Primary Functions and/or Responsibilities:

  • Leads the end-to-end delivery of projects, ensuring scope, timeline, and budget are met with high quality and business impact
  • Develops detailed project plans, manages task assignments, and proactively identifies risks, bottlenecks, and mitigation strategies
  • Collaborates with stakeholders across departments to ensure alignment on goals, expectations, and deliverables
  • Serves as the primary liaison between project teams and business leaders; facilitates clear communication, manages executive updates, and ensures project transparency
  • Tracks project KPIs, analyzes trends, and makes objective recommendations for course correction or optimization
  • Ensures documentation, compliance, and process standards are consistently followed using the Bank’s project methodology and tools
  • Fosters a collaborative environment across project teams and encourages ownership, shared accountability, and performance growth
  • Leads and contributes to transformation initiatives and continuous improvement efforts across the enterprise
  • Supports internal process updates, documentation, and knowledge sharing across the EPMO
  • Delivers executive-level summaries and reports to communicate project status, risks, and outcomes with clarity and business relevance
  • Contributes to the evolution of EPMO tools and templates, including Clarity updates and process enhancements
  • Leads or supports internal committee work related to project governance, prioritization, or PMO strategy
  • Provides mentorship and knowledge sharing with peers as needed

Hiring Salary Range

The hiring range below reflects targeted base salary. Actual compensation will be determined based on the candidate’s prior related experience & education and will be finalized at the time of offer. In addition to base salary, most positions are also eligible to participate in our annual bonus program. Select positions may also be eligible to earn incentives and/or commissions. Hiring Base Salary Range: PM II: $88,000 - $104,500 plus annual bonus. PM I: $76,000 - $91,000 plus annual bonus.
